Week 10: Frustrated With Your Ad Campaign?

We all know the frustrations that can emerge when using Google Adwords. We might often wonder why campaigns are not getting any clicks or generate any impressions. Often it can be due to a low quality score, or not enough money being spent on the actual bid, which can cause your ads to not even be displayed.

If your ad is not showing up then it is due to you not having enough good quality content to support the given set of keywords. Google scans the keywords with their advanced analytics technology to sort of the highest quality scores from the low’s. Quality score is basically the relevance of your ad and your pay-per-click ad. The quality score is important because the better the score is, the less money you would have to invest into your cost-per-click bid. These two multiples ultimately makes up your Ad Rank. 

It is important that users remember to make sure that their site experience is optimized for mobile, or at least try to target users on mobile devices with specific mobile-friendly ads and pages. The user’s device is taken into account when ad quality is calculated. It can be extremely beneficial to your ad if you make sure that the information is easy to find and the navigation is intuitive for users on mobile devices.

Also, make sure that your ads are relevant to users searches and intentions. This is literally the heart of adword quality. This will allow your ads and sites to help users gather relevant information, complete a sale, and navigate easily.

Week 5: Call Out Extensions

Image result for call out extension in google ads


Call extensions can be a great opportunity for your business to thrive and drive visitors to your content.  Often in the past, markets would find creative ways to use site links in their pay-per-click ads to communicate key benefits. Call-Out extensions can allow a user to get an extra line of text to communicate your companies value and also boost your quality score, which ultimately reduces your costs. Another benefit that users can get from using call-outs include freeing up site links. Sometimes users come across situations in which their site links were never being clicked on. In this situation, you can convert them to callout extensions and use the site links for click throughs that lead directly to your site content.

Keep in mind that there are no additional cost to run callout extensions. Each extension can be up to 25 characters and they should not duplicate content from your ad or other extensions.  When you want to evaluate your extension, you can view your click through rate which assess how many times our ads viewed. This is extremely important because it allows us to analyze the data to see which callout extension is helping your ad the most. We can then use this data when it is time to create future call out extensions.

Finally, once you start gathering data from successful extensions, you have to build upon it. Once you start noticing the traffic that certain extensions can bring your cite, you can start capitalizing and driving profits.

This week, we looked at search terms report and how to adjust your strategy based off the report.  For example, if you are looking at your reports and notice traffic entering your cite but not equally reflected with sales, then one strategy that you can use is to decide to get rid of negative keywords that are completely irrelevant to your ad.

Search term reports can be used to see how your ads performed when they are triggered by searches within a search network. As stated before, you can determine how closely actual searches are related to your selected keywords and also identify search terms with the highest potential. Keep in mind that the performance metrics on the search term report may differ from the data in the product groups, since it reports traffic for queries that meet Google’s privacy initiation.

When looking at your search report you will notice two columns, one is the keyword column and the other is the match type column. The keyword column tells you which one of your keywords matches someone’s search term and triggered your ad. This can be useful to help you see your keywords in action by giving you a visual representation on how the are matching to actual searches. The Match type column in your report tells you how closely the search terms that triggered your ads on Google are related to the actual keywords in your account. By determining which match types are working well for which keywords and searches, you can change/improve match types for all your keywords to optimize your campaign and bring in the right customers that are looking for your product or service.
